Find out If the School Is Accredited

Different states have different laws and curriculum that needs to be followed. It is best o find out if the school has the accreditation and curriculum or driving course that is state-approved. It would demotivate you to waste time in a school that has no accreditation.

Check the Training Schedule and Instructors

consider the facilities and instructorsIt would help if you checked your classes’ schedule to find if it works with yours for you to manage to attend school. Find a flexible school to fit your schedule to not miss any classes or exams in school. Furthermore, for you to have a smooth learning experience, a school with enough instructors is the best. An ideal school should have enough instructors to give each student the necessary attention during classes. The instructor should be well-vetted and trained and mentor you and help you gain confidence in your work.

What is a Boutique Workspace?

Also known as shift or virtual workspace, a boutique workspace or office is aroom furnished office building that you can rent by the hour or by the day. They are meant to provide the functionality of having your office when you need one, without having to sign an extensive lease agreement.

This type of office space is very cost effective for smaller businesses or those who work from home which may only need to be in the office one or two days a week.

They Typically Offer an Assortment of Services and Amenities

Boutique workspaces are meant to be a functional office space that you do not have to set-up or furnish yourself. To meet this requirement they typically offer included in your daily rent or for an additional fee items such as:

  • Furnished Officework place Space
  • Waiting Area
  • Phone and Fax Lines
  • Conference Rooms (Usually with advanced booking)
  • Reception Staffing
  • A Street Address

Virtual or boutique offices are a great way to provide a big company feel to your smaller business without the added overhead. They are available when you need them, and you only pay for the time you use, versus having an office that you would have to pay for the whole month whether you use it or not.
